Output 2671895ad6ecaf05825e8a4a29426f3b08c2861f699bd49cf9fe6c58f75bc020:0

value
3779
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d66823fb6c3a30242025c793a1abcefe09fc2c334281d7a360de47d5673365c
address
bc1pe4ngy0akcw3sysszt3un5x4ualsflskrxs5p673kphj864nnxewqggnyzw
transaction
2671895ad6ecaf05825e8a4a29426f3b08c2861f699bd49cf9fe6c58f75bc020
spent
true